<<Disclaimer: Verify this information before applying it to your situation.>> Hi Everyone, I recently posted requesting a gluten free hot sauce that I did not have to mail order. I received the following suggestions: 1. Gluten-free hot sauces purchased from hot sauce specialty stores or sometimes from gourmet oriented grocery stores. I have several different flavors, even chipotle. 2. Tostitos brand is gf. 3. I believe that chef Paul ( the one from the TV show) puts one out.He is the one that looks like Dom DeLouise. I believe that he has a website that you can verify. I spoke to him at the food show last year and if I remember correctly it was gf, but please verify with him. 4. Thai Kitchen 'Spicy Thai Chili Sauce' is gluten free. The Thai Kitchen company is based in Berkely, California, so I am not sure if this is a regional product or not. I purchase it from QFC food stores in the Seattle/Tacoma area of Washington State. 5. Frank's Red Hot Sauce and Frank's Red Hot Buffalo Wing Sauce are both GF. I called the manufacturer who verified it and have used it with no problem. Others recommended making your own: Recipes included: - I make my own using a can of chopped Rotel tomatoes plus a small can of tomato sauce. - try tomatoes cooked into a sauce, apple cider vinegar, and horseradish - Try combining GF ketchup, rice vinegar and Japanese Wasabi, a horse radish paste in a tube. It's great. - use Chinese hot oil with whatever sauce you already like. Heather Oklahoma City, OK USA
